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/git/23.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
EclipseGit:History视图仅显示本地历史,而不是远程历史_Eclipse_Git_History_Egit - Fatal编程技术网

EclipseGit:History视图仅显示本地历史,而不是远程历史

EclipseGit:History视图仅显示本地历史,而不是远程历史,eclipse,git,history,egit,Eclipse,Git,History,Egit,我过去可以看到文件的实际提交历史记录,但现在我只看到本地历史记录: 发生了什么变化?通过单击Windows>Show view>Git存储库打开Git存储库查看 在此视图中选择您的存储库。右键单击它,然后选择Show In>History选项 如果您想查看给定文件的历史记录(如图所示,例如:server.js)。在包资源管理器/Navigator/Project explorer视图中选择/定位此文件,然后右键单击此文件,然后选择Team>Show in History选项。即使您有一个git

我过去可以看到文件的实际提交历史记录,但现在我只看到本地历史记录:


发生了什么变化?

通过单击
Windows>Show view>Git存储库打开Git存储库查看

在此视图中选择您的存储库。右键单击它,然后选择
Show In>History
选项


如果您想查看给定文件的历史记录(如图所示,例如:server.js)。在包资源管理器/Navigator/Project explorer视图中选择/定位此文件,然后右键单击此文件,然后选择
Team>Show in History
选项。

即使您有一个git项目,它也可以工作:右键单击文件上的“包资源管理器”或“项目资源管理器”。选择选项“与”->“本地历史进行比较…”


为了解决这个问题,我只需单击历史视图中最右边的按钮,名为“显示所有分支和标记”,如下所示,这是拆分后指向下方的两个箭头

主分支在前面几次提交,没有显示是否“打开”


我认为这很有效。。。不确定,因为现在我无法回到这个“本地历史”视图。如果没有团队>在历史中显示选项怎么办?你怎么知道的?我曾经有过它,但在下载并安装了最新的eclipse-java-kepler-SR2-macosx-cocoa-x86_64之后,我再也找不到了。@user2568374将其作为单独的问题发布。stackoverflow中不鼓励使用链接式讨论线程。“链接式讨论”之间有什么区别问一个与答案直接相关的特定问题?@user2568374:我也有同样的问题,可以通过在项目浏览器中右键单击项目并转到团队->共享项目来解决。这似乎没有回答问题,而且已经有了一个可接受的答案。